Do czego w programowaniu używa się struktur danych?
W programowaniu struktury danych są niezwykle ważne. Są to specjalne sposoby organizacji i przechowywania danych, które umożliwiają skuteczne zarządzanie informacjami w programach komputerowych. Struktury danych są nieodłączną częścią każdego programu i są używane do różnych celów, takich jak przechowywanie, sortowanie, wyszukiwanie i manipulowanie danymi.
1. Przechowywanie danych
Jednym z głównych zastosowań struktur danych jest przechowywanie danych w sposób, który umożliwia łatwy dostęp i manipulację. Na przykład, jeśli chcemy przechowywać listę imion, możemy użyć struktury danych o nazwie tablica. Tablica pozwala nam przechowywać wiele elementów w jednym miejscu i odwoływać się do nich za pomocą indeksów.
Przykład:
„`python
imiona = [„Anna”, „Jan”, „Maria”]
„`
2. Sortowanie danych
Struktury danych są również używane do sortowania danych w programowaniu. Sortowanie polega na uporządkowaniu elementów w określonej kolejności. Na przykład, jeśli mamy listę liczb, możemy użyć struktury danych o nazwie lista, aby posortować je rosnąco lub malejąco.
Przykład:
„`python
liczby = [5, 2, 8, 1, 9]
liczby.sort()
„`
3. Wyszukiwanie danych
Struktury danych umożliwiają również efektywne wyszukiwanie danych w programach. Wyszukiwanie polega na znalezieniu określonego elementu w zbiorze danych. Na przykład, jeśli mamy listę imion, możemy użyć struktury danych o nazwie słownik, aby wyszukać konkretną osobę po jej imieniu.
Przykład:
„`python
osoby = {„Anna”: 25, „Jan”: 30, „Maria”: 35}
wiek = osoby[„Jan”]
„`
4. Manipulowanie danymi
Struktury danych umożliwiają również manipulowanie danymi w programach. Manipulowanie polega na zmianie, dodawaniu lub usuwaniu elementów w zbiorze danych. Na przykład, jeśli mamy listę liczb, możemy użyć struktury danych o nazwie stos, aby dodawać i usuwać elementy z góry stosu.
Przykład:
„`python
stos = []
stos.append(1)
stos.append(2)
element = stos.pop()
„`
Podsumowanie
Struktury danych są niezwykle ważne w programowaniu i mają wiele zastosowań. Są używane do przechowywania, sortowania, wyszukiwania i manipulowania danymi. Bez struktur danych programowanie byłoby znacznie trudniejsze i mniej efektywne. Dlatego warto zrozumieć, jak działają różne struktury danych i jak można je wykorzystać w programach komputerowych.
Struktury danych są używane w programowaniu do organizowania i przechowywania danych w sposób efektywny i zgodny z określonymi wymaganiami. Pozwalają na manipulację danymi, wyszukiwanie, sortowanie i wykonywanie różnych operacji na danych. Umożliwiają również optymalizację wydajności programu.
Link tagu HTML do strony https://cellulit.info.pl/:
https://cellulit.info.pl/